@charset "utf-8";
body {
/*	font-family: "Times New Roman", Times, serif; */
	font-family: "Arial", Arial, sans-serif;
/*	letter-spacing:-1px; */
	background-color: #000000;
	color: #949494;
	top: auto;
	align: center;
	vertical-align: middle;
	text-align: center;
}
#mitte {
	background-position: center center;
	padding: 10px;
	margin: auto;
	width: 1000px;
	top: auto;
	text-align: center;
}
a {
	color: #949494;
	text-decoration: none;
}
a:hover {
	color: #FFFFFF;
	text-decoration: none;
}

#mitte #mitte2 img {
	padding-left: -20px;
}


/* --- */
/* cookie notice */

body>aside.cookie-notice{
display:block;
position:sticky;
bottom:0;
background-color:rgba(20,20,20,.9);
z-index:100;
color:rgb(255,255,255);
font-size:.8rem;
}

body>aside.cookie-notice>section{
display:block;
padding:.5rem calc((100% - 60rem) / 2 + 2.5rem) .5rem calc((100% - 60rem) / 2 + 10rem);
margin:0 auto;
}

body>aside.cookie-notice>section>p{
margin-bottom:.5rem;
}

body>aside.cookie-notice>section>a{
display:inline-block;
cursor:pointer;
outline:none;
letter-spacing:.1rem;
padding:.25rem .5rem .25rem 1rem;
text-decoration:none;
text-transform:uppercase;
position:relative;
}